Dear Flavien,

a good and simple start would be to open a Merge Request (MR) adding a
patch on salsa: https://salsa.debian.org/games-team/ogre

Then salsa CI will test your changes and it can be sponsored by someone.


There was ongoing work to update to 1.12.13  but it stalled:
https://salsa.debian.org/games-team/ogre/-/merge_requests/6

The main work is likely to identify what needs to change for the
copyright file to be acceptable


If you want to get started on ogre 14 you could start by combining the
changes in the 1.12.13 branch with those here
https://salsa.debian.org/games-team/ogre/-/commits/ogre-13.3/?ref_type=heads

I'm currently super short on time but will try to help you with any
technical problems if you open a MR for a patch

Best regards from Freiburg

Simon

Am 06.03.24 um 08:46 schrieb Flavien Bridault:

Dear maintainer(s),

I took a look at the latest version of Ogre which is probably
compatible with latest ImGui and it seems this line is no longer
necessary. It was removed before the release 13.0.0 when upgrading to
ImGUI 1.83 :
https://github.com/OGRECave/ogre/commit/17b7481057b97662a3752ee605ea77a9eb0c57db

Patching should be then fairly easy...

I can offer my help again, like I did to upgrade to 1.14
(https://lists.debian.org/debian-devel-games/2023/11/msg00001.html),
which whould really be the best option in the end... Maybe I will have
an official answer this time ? I don't want to be sarcastic at all,
but I strongly depend on Ogre to build sight and this is annoying to
get no answer from the devel games team. And currently my package
sight is currently marked for autoremoval because of this bug
(https://tracker.debian.org/pkg/sight)

Kind regards,

--

*Dr. Flavien BRIDAULT*
Director of Software Development
IRCAD France & IRCAD Africa

flavien.brida...@ircad.fr <mailto:flavien.bridault-louc...@ircad.fr>
Tél. : +33 (0)3 88 119 201
                IRCAD France
http://www.ircad.fr/
http://www.ircad.africa/ <http://www.ircad.fr/>

Suivez l'IRCAD sur Facebook
<http://www.facebook.com/pages/IRCAD/193785273990141>

*IRCAD France*
Hôpitaux Universitaires - 1, place de l'Hôpital - 67091 Strasbourg
Cedex - FRANCE

Reply via email to